57509529
2277280
1666165
40886487
34322090
46018339
12814499
58024159
50697682
43671560
22611272
31614183
78777357
62751329
34281466
54126107
28344187
87037635
83713317
52939567
34943096
37808660
2462426
28986764
35844362
854785
77984784
99527132
7866860
4069375
22858378
12165908
9171614
34304976
86621354
79644920
1935215
53109079
40261586
55329875